Three Way Calling
You can hold a conversation with two other external
callers. You can speak to both people at the same time or
choose to switch between both callers. This facility does
not include calls between more than two handsets on
intercom feature.
To make a three-way call
Make the first call as normal. Then:
• Press the ➔ button until the display shows
3 WAY CALL.
• Press the ✔ button. Your first caller is put on hold.
Display shows
ENTER NO.
• Dial the number you want for the second call.
• Press the ➔ button until display shows
JOIN CALLS.
• Press the ✔ button. You and your two callers can now
have a three-way conversation.
• To end the three-way call, press the TALK button or
place the handset back on the base station.
For full details of the switching options available, see the
Select Services User Guide.
